Dell P2222H Monitor Has No Video When Connected to a Dock Through HDMI or DisplayPort
Summary: This article provides information about the no video issue seen with a Dell P2222H monitor when connected to a dock using HDMI or DisplayPort.

Symptoms
Dell P2222H monitor may have no video when it is connected to a Dell Dock WD19 using HDMI or DisplayPort, and the dock is connected to the computer using USB-C. A message indicating that no DisplayPort cable is connected may show if the monitor has a DisplayPort cable connected to it but not to the computer. The external monitor does not display, but the computer detects the monitor model information.
Affected Monitor:
- Dell P2222H
Affected Dock:
- Dell Dock WD19
Affected Platforms:
- Latitude 5340
- Latitude 5350
- Latitude 5540
- Latitude 5550
- Latitude 7340
Cause
This is due to the firmware issue of the USB-C Power Delivery controller Integrated Circuit.
Resolution
Refer to the following table and update the latest BIOS to resolve the issue. To download and install the BIOS, reference the BIOS Update Guide.
| Platform | BIOS version | Release Date |
| Latitude 5340 | 1.21.0 or later | Available |
| Latitude 5350 | 1.13.0 or later | Available |
| Latitude 5540 | 1.21.0 or later | Available |
| Latitude 5550 | 1.14.0 or later | Available |
| Latitude 7340 | 1.22.0 or later | Available |
